Nervous patient successfully put at ease thanks to Leeds dentist

Getting your teeth checked regularly by a dental professional is vital in ensuring that you have a healthy mouth, allowing you to eat, drink and talk in comfort. But the unfortunate fact is that a surprisingly large number of people in the United Kingdom feel nervous about visiting the dentist. It is a problem that needs to be overcome so that, if you have any issues with your mouth they can be dealt with without progressing into something much worse.
The reason dental anxiety can be so hard to overcome is that it often has its roots in childhood experiences. Memories of painful procedures as a younger person can be especially vivid and difficult to deal with, particularly if this is compounded by a fear of needles.
Patients are sometimes nervous about visiting the dentist because of a personality clash which occurred at the surgery. Things can often seem a lot worse than they actually are and it is worth talking things out or even finding another dental practice if you feel the standard of service was not up to scratch.
Those who have not been to the dentist in some time often feel embarrassed about the state of their teeth and are unwilling to have them examined. You should be aware though that dentists have seen it all and they are only concerned with correcting problems, not judging you as a person.
The important thing to remember is that dentistry has changed a lot in the past few decades and modern dentists go to great lengths to relax their patients if they are ill at ease.
